Drug treatment services for the hearing impaired are available in both an outpatient and inpatient setting. People with hearing impairment can be at a higher risk of substance abuse disorders as a result of their impairment. living with a major handicap can be a source of distress, discouragement, depression and apathy for both adolescents and adults who may turn to drugs or alcohol to cope with these feelings and emotions. Drug treatment facilities that have full time staff to assist the hearing impaired are the most ideal facilities to select. Some programs may only employ part-time staff to interpret and assist this demographic, which this means hearing impaired clients won't benefit as much as everyone else and will miss out on important activities they should be attending every day. There could be video presentations available which utilize sign language as well, which can also be extremely helpful.
There are agencies and organizations which can provide hearing impaired people suffering with substance abuse issues with resources and information to find the recovery services they need. One is the Deaf Off Drugs and Alcohol (DODA).
